Ok so I talked to Texas Speed and told them about my goals and they recommended the following. Please let me know what y'all think or if y'all have any other input.
Cam: Texas Speed Torquer V4 231/234 .629/.615 111 lsa
Heads: PRC As-Cast 225cc LS1/LS2 Cathedral Heads with 62cc Chambers
Valve Springs:- PRC .650" Lift Dual Valvesprings with Titanium Retainers
Lifters: LS7 Style Lifters
Timing Chain: LS2 Timing Chain
Oil Pump: TSP Ported Oil Pump
Headers: TSP 1 7/8" Stainless Long Tube Headers
Still need to figure out:
-Injectors
-Fuel Pump
-Intake
-Stall (I have a stall right now but its only a 2100 and I don't think that will be enough)
So with this heads and cam setup is 400 rwhp achievable? Thanks for your input!

Stock heads will get to you to 400 horsepower, so you could save a big chunk on money there.
Marine 8.1 injectors are like 42lbs I think, those should be plenty of injector. A walbro 255 fuel pump will be good.
NNBS intake manifold like we have talked about before in this thread.

Ok thanks for your response! If the stock heads will get me over the 400 rwhp goal thats great but if I can make more, I'm willing to. Also something I forgot to say the truck is a 2500 on 33s so drivetrain loss will be greater.
#16
I wouldnt get your hopes up too much on the 400 rwhp. Im the same boat as you, 33s on a 2500 4wd. When I had my old turbo at 7 psi it only put down 380 rwhp. At the crank yeah 400 no problem. Like right now I put down 460 with a bigger turbo and 11 psi but guys with my same setup in a 2wd make 500-550 all the time. Dont get hung up on numbers thats what I had to learn
